Mah Jongg!

Mah Jongg is a rummy game that uses tiles. It can be played with 2, 3 or 4 people. Looking for an extra challenge? At Game Friendzy we teach & play American Mah Jongg, but you can also play Siamese Mah Jongg — an expansion of American Mah Jongg where the goal is to get 2 mah jonggs per hand. Canasta!

Canasta is a card game played with two full decks of regular cards, including the jokers. We like to call it Grown-Up Go Fish. The goal is to collect points by grouping like cards together and creating completed canastas (a canasta is 7 of a kind). Most people play a 4-person partnership version of Canasta. Are there other versions? Of course! You can play two or three person Canasta, or you can play an extended form of Canasta called Hand and Foot that allows for more than four players.
